2012-08-06 135 views
0
/var/ 
    /www/ 
    /test/ 

这是我的目录结构。我试图把各种串在我的.htaccess(内部的/ var/www),以尝试将访问者重定向到/test/,但无论我得到一个500错误,或不停地尝试访问http://mysite/testtesttesttesttest ...如何使用.htaccess将一个目录重定向到另一个目录?

谁能告诉我正确的串?这是我尝试过的。

Redirect . test 
Redirect ./ test 
Redirect ./ /test 
Redirect/./test 

回答

0

试试这个在您的文档根目录添加到htaccess文件(/var/www):

RewriteEngine On 
RewriteCond %{REQUEST_URI} !^/test 
RewriteRule ^(.*)$ /test/$1 [L] 

添加R标志的支架,如果你想重定向浏览器,而不是在内部改写服务器上:[R=301,L]或只是[R,L](对于302)。

相关问题